Schwab Corporate Real Estate contributes to the success of the company by providing superior brand and business positioning for Schwab across corporate office and retail branch locations. The group effectively and efficiently manages the transactional operations of the firm’s portfolio of properties including the selection and negotiation of future and existing real estate sites.

The Real Estate Transaction Manager (Individual Contributor) will be responsible for the transaction management of real estate activity for a leased portfolio consisting of retail and office locations across the United States.

Daily responsibilities include:

  • Execute the strategy defined by Schwab leadership.
  • Monitor critical lease dates and report transactional progress.
  • Review and negotiate new and existing leases, renewals, extensions, relocations, buyouts and subleases.
  • Perform market research, property evaluations, and existing lease analysis for renewals (market rents, lease terms, current conditions, property ownership).
  • Conduct market surveys, site selection tours, and negotiations.
  • Prepare Letters of Intent and Requests for Proposals, Notices, and Lease Execution Packages.
  • Coordinate and communicate with attorneys and partners across construction, design, property management, lease administration, finance, and strategy.
  • Engage and manage brokers, as required, for select lease transactions.
  • Communicate with Landlords to negotiate renewals and resolve disputes.
  • Attend regular internal and project conference calls.
  • Perform administrative and reporting tasks.
  • Minimal travel required.
